What tools can reduce the physical effort during large prep sessions? Find out which gadgets can make chopping and cooking in bulk much easier.

Food processors, stand mixers, and mandolines are excellent tools for reducing physical effort during large prep sessions by automating repetitive tasks like chopping, mixing, and slicing.

Detailed Explanation:

When preparing large quantities of food, repetitive tasks can lead to fatigue and strain. Several tools can significantly reduce physical effort:

  1. Food Processor: A food processor is invaluable for chopping vegetables, grating cheese, making sauces, and even kneading dough. Its powerful motor and various attachments can accomplish these tasks much faster and with less effort than doing them manually.

  2. Stand Mixer: For baking or tasks requiring extensive mixing, a stand mixer is a lifesaver. It can handle large batches of dough, batter, or frosting without requiring constant manual stirring. Different attachments, like the whisk, paddle, and dough hook, make it versatile for various recipes.

  3. Mandoline: A mandoline slicer allows you to quickly and uniformly slice vegetables and fruits. This is especially helpful when you need consistent slices for dishes like gratins, salads, or chips. Be sure to use the safety guard to protect your fingers.

  4. Electric Vegetable Chopper: Smaller than a food processor, an electric vegetable chopper is perfect for quickly chopping onions, garlic, herbs, and other vegetables. It's easy to clean and store, making it a convenient option for smaller tasks.

  5. Immersion Blender: An immersion blender (also known as a stick blender) is great for pureeing soups and sauces directly in the pot, eliminating the need to transfer hot liquids to a blender. This reduces both effort and cleanup.

Pro Tip:

When using a food processor, avoid overfilling it. Overfilling can strain the motor and result in uneven processing. Work in batches for best results.
